An Edward VII silver-mounted claret jug, Dowler & Sons, Birmingham, 1902
the tapering square body cut with printies and faceted circle motifs, surmounted by a silver collar with a mask below the spout, the side applied with an s-scroll handle terminating in a shield-shaped cartouche, shaped thumbpiece, minor chips, 27,3cm high
